drm: make minor->index available early
Browse files Browse the repository at this point in the history
Instead of allocating the minor-index during registration, we now do this
during allocation. This way, debug-messages between minor-allocation and
minor-registration will now use the correct minor instead of 0. Same is
done for unregistration vs. free, so debug-messages between
device-shutdown and device-destruction show proper indices.

Even though minor-indices are allocated early, we don't enable minor
lookup early. Instead, we keep the entry set to NULL and replace it during
registration / unregistration. This way, the index is allocated but lookup
only works if registered.
